Thanks - I think that I figured out what type of chicks we have:

1 - New Hampshire Red
3 - Red Stars
2 - Partridge Plymoth Rocks
1 - Golden Laced Wyndotte
3 - Cuckoo Marans, I think? - there are a lot of black and white chicks out there but this chicken seems to be more black than white like ours.

I think we have a good mix of chicks. I am wondering how many eggs each lays?
nh- 4/week
rs-6
part. rock- IDK- didn't see that one
wyan-3
marans-3

Got these numbers recently off a website and had written them down...will try to find it. Of course every hen is different! Some will be good layers and some not.
